Battle Bridge Canine offers five core programs: Private Lessons for hands-on owner coaching; Puppy Board and Train for foundational skills in young dogs; Obedience Board and Train for structured command reinforcement; Behavior Modification Board and Train for aggression, reactivity, and fear-based issues; and Refresher Boarding for maintaining skills. All board and train programs include a halfway lesson and a go-home lesson with the owner, plus a free follow-up private lesson after completion. Training occurs in-home and in public settings to ensure real-world readiness. Programs are individually tailored and do not follow fixed schedules.

About the Trainer

Battle Bridge Canine is a small, owner-operated dog training and behavioral center based in Newton Grove, NC, serving dog owners across the Triangle Area and surrounding counties. Founded by Caitlyn Parker, the business offers personalized training solutions tailored to each dog’s needs, focusing on balanced training techniques that combine rewards and corrections to create clear, consistent communication. Services include private lessons, board and train programs for puppies, obedience, behavior modification, and refresher boarding. A key advantage is their commitment to owner education—clients receive hands-on guidance during halfway and go-home lessons, plus a free post-program private lesson. Training occurs in real-life environments, including homes and public spaces, ensuring dogs generalize skills beyond the facility. With a maximum of three dogs trained at a time, Caitlyn provides focused, individualized attention. She also offers daily photo and video updates during board and train stays to keep owners informed and connected.

Caitlyn has formal training from Highland Canine’s six-month program and has been training professionally since 2019, building experience through a large boarding facility before launching her own business. She uses slip leads, prong collars, and e-collars as part of her balanced approach, with full explanations provided during consultations. The business prioritizes building trust, structure, and engagement between dogs and their owners, helping resolve issues like reactivity, leash pulling, jumping, biting, and separation anxiety.

All clients receive ongoing support via text or phone after training, and the business serves dogs of all breeds, ages, and problem types with no one-size-fits-all programs.
